JOB OVERVIEW

We have a fantastic new job opportunity for a Fire Sprinkler Repair and Maintenance Engineer who has experience in a similar role repairing and/or servicing fire sprinkler systems, excellent problem-solving and fault-finding skills and good communication and IT skills.

Working as a Fire Sprinkler Repair and Maintenance Engineer you will play a crucial role in ensuring the ongoing reliability and effectiveness of fire sprinkler systems, maintaining the safety of lives and property.

Beyond testing and inspections, the Fire Sprinkler Repair and Maintenance Engineer will play a key role in identifying and reporting any defects or deficiencies discovered. Your expertise will be essential in diagnosing issues, recommending appropriate solutions, and sometimes carrying out minor repairs and maintenance to keep systems in optimal working order.

DUTIES

Your duties as a Fire Sprinkler Repair and Maintenance Engineer include:

  • Weekly Routine Testing of Wet & Dry & Alternate Type Systems
  • Installation Flow Testing & Fire Pump Flow Testing
  • Pre-Checks of Foam Enhanced Systems and perform safe isolation and reinstatement
  • Install/replace valve stations and manifold, install/replace sprinkler mains (large diameter and small)
  • Have a good awareness of health and safety
